#fa9d1f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a9d1f is composed of 98% red, 61.6%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.2% magenta, 87.6%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 34.5 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 55.1%. #fa9d1f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ff3e with #f53b00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

#fa9d1f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fa9d1f has RGB values of R:250, G:157, B:31 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.88,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16424223.

Shades and Tints of #fa9d1f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060400 is the darkest color, while #fff9f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fa9d1f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908d89 is the less saturated color, while #fa9d1f is the most saturated one.
